Abstract
In our previous work [Phys. Rev. A 89, 022329 (2014)], we proposed a teleportation-based quantum communication scheme in a quantum wireless multihop network with arbitrary types of Bell pairs shared between adjacent nodes. Here we revised the scheme by introducing a result-mapping method for halving the classical communication cost, with which the source and intermediate nodes map the measurement outcomes to those corresponding to the target Bell pair type assigned by the destination node. A routing protocol is utilized to piggyback the target Bell pair type notification information which introduces no extra communication cost.
